The Most Popular Procedures Performed by Cosmetic Dentists

Do you wish for a perfect smile? You’re not alone. Everyone dreams of a perfect smile and perfectly aligned, white teeth. Cosmetic dentistry is the magic wand that can grant your wish. Your cosmetic dentist can provide several treatments to fix your teeth and your smile.

Teeth Whitening

Teeth whitening is one of the most common cosmetic dental treatments. Whitening treatments produce dramatic and lasting results for anyone who wants white, bright teeth.

Teeth can become stained or discoloured, especially if you regularly consume coffee, tea or wine. Smoking and some medications can also stain your teeth. A whitening treatment can make your teeth look whiter and brighter. With good care, the results of a whitening treatment may last weeks, even months.

There are two types of whitening treatments:

  1. Home whitening treatment: Over-the-counter, home whitening treatments use trays filled with a whitening gel. You have to wear them for some time every day.
  2. In-office whitening treatments: In a whitening treatment at the dentist’s office, the dentist will use stronger whitening agents while making sure your gums and mouth are safe during the process.

Veneers

Whitening treatments can help people with stained or discoloured teeth. But what about chipped, or slightly crooked teeth?

Veneers are thin teeth covers or shells made with porcelain, ceramic or composite resin. They are attached to the surface of the teeth to fix cosmetic dental issues. The veneers treatment usually takes longer than whitening treatments. The dentist will remove some enamel from your teeth to prepare them for veneers. Impressions of your teeth may be taken to customize veneers for your teeth. The dentist will check the fit and colour of the veneers and bond them to your teeth. Veneers can successfully cover dental imperfections to give you a flawless look and smile.

Dental Implants

Whitening treatments and veneers can take care of damaged or stained teeth. But if you have lost one or more teeth, you need to a permanent and natural-looking replacement. That solution is dental implants.

A dental implant is an artificial tooth root, usually made of titanium. The dentist will insert it in the jawbone where the original tooth was. With time, the implant fuses with the bone. Then the dentist attaches an artificial tooth - a crown, or a bridge on the top. The new tooth appears and feels just like a natural tooth. You can now eat, speak, and smile with confidence. Dental implants are strong and last long. They preserve the jawbone too and they function just like natural teeth.

Invisalign and Braces

Crooked teeth are not just a cosmetic issue. They can affect your bite and impact your oral health. Your dentist can fix crooked teeth with the help of braces or Invisalign.

Invisalign are clear aligners made with plastic. They can slowly shift your teeth into the right place. Being nearly invisible, they don’t cause any aesthetic issues. You can remove them at meal times or at the time of brushing your teeth.

Traditional braces were cumbersome but modern braces are smaller and less obvious. They can also fix complex alignment issues. Both braces and Invisalign require time to produce results.

Treatment may take months, even years, but you achieve a beautifully straight smile as a result.

Your dentist will help make the best choice for your needs, preferences and goals.

Composite Bonding

Chipped, cracked, and discoloured teeth can be repaired with bonding materials. These materials blend perfectly with your natural teeth and quickly fix minor dental issues. Bonding is a simple process in which your dentist will apply a tooth-coloured resin to the tooth. It will be shaped to make it blend with the natural tooth. A special light will be used to harden the bonding material. Since composite bonding produces natural results, you achieve a beautiful smile.
